Film Synopsis
Background to Danger (1943) centers on an American businessman traveling through neutral Turkey who accepts a mysterious package from a frightened stranger aboard a train. As enemy agents pursue him across Istanbul and shifting alliances blur the line between friend and foe, he becomes an unwilling participant in a dangerous struggle between Nazi operatives and Allied intelligence. This wartime espionage thriller combines international intrigue with fast-paced suspense, emphasizing deception, courage, resourcefulness, and the uncertainty of trust during global conflict.
